检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
参数名称 说明 regionId 表示当前您所在的区域,可在华为云官网登录云服务后在浏览器的地址栏中获取。例如cn-north-4。 cfModuleHide 值header_sidebar_floatlayer,表示隐藏华为云console页面页头页脚和菜单栏。 leftMenuCollapsed
您可以: 根据企业的业务组织,在您的华为云账号中,给企业中不同职能部门的员工创建IAM用户,让员工拥有唯一安全凭证,并使用APM资源。 根据企业用户的职能,设置不同的访问权限,以达到用户之间的权限隔离。 将APM资源委托给更专业、高效的其他华为云账号或者云服务,这些账号或者云服务可以根据权限进行代运维。
如果您需要对您所拥有的APM进行精细的权限管理,您可以使用统一身份认证服务(Identity and Access Management,简称IAM),如果华为云账号已经能满足您的要求,不需要创建独立的IAM用户,您可以跳过本章节,不影响您使用APM的其它功能。 默认情况下,新建的IAM用户没有任
错误监控采集 错误监控采集(AppError)是错误监控采集器,获取错误监控相关信息。包括:类别、指标、指标名称、指标说明、单位、数据类型以及默认聚合方式。 表1 错误监控采集(AppError)指标说明 指标类别 指标 指标名称 指标说明 单位 数据类型 默认聚合方式 网络错误指标集
如何使用APM Profiler定位性能问题 APM Profiler 是一种持续性能剖析工具,可以帮助开发者准确找到应用程序中消耗资源最多的代码位置。 前提条件 APM Agent 已接入,操作方法参见开始监控JAVA应用。 Profiler功能已开启,操作方法参见Profiler性能分析。
调用链数据 调用链Span数据 通过https加密结合AKSK鉴权的方式传输 APM服务端按照Project隔离存储 调用链前台查询展示 可配置,最大7天,到期彻底删除 调用请求KPI数据 调用发起方地址、调用接收方地址、调用接口、调用耗时、调用状态 通过https加密结合AKSK鉴权的方式传输
探针操作 通过探针管理您可以查看当前已接入Agent的部署状态及运行状态,并且能对接入的Agent进行停止、启动和删除操作。 查看探针 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。 在左侧导航栏选择“应用监控 > 探针管理”。 在探针管理页查看探针列表。
能,降低您使用SDK的难度,推荐使用。 SDK列表 表1提供了APM服务支持的SDK列表,您可以在GitHub仓库查看SDK更新历史、获取安装包以及查看指导文档。 表1 SDK列表 编程语言 Github地址 参考文档 Java huaweicloud-sdk-java-v3 Java
integer JAVA 800 2.1.14 - 超过慢请求阈值的方法提高采样率。 kafka消费方法配置 obj_array JAVA - 2.1.14 - kafka消费方法配置。 表2 KafkaConsumer监控指标说明 指标类别 指标 指标名称 指标说明 单位 数据类型
板。 登录APM控制台,在左侧导航栏中选择“告警中心 > 阈值规则”。 在右上角单击“添加批量阈值规则”。 根据界面提示配置参数,具体如表1所示。 表1 配置参数 参数 说明 示例 阈值名称 输入阈值名称。 apm 描述 输入描述信息。 - 作用到所有应用 若开关为:当您开启后,
参数名 数据类型 应用类型 默认值 Agent支持的起始版本 Agent支持的终止版本 描述 url规整配置 obj_array JAVA - 2.0.0 - 根据url规整配置,将一些restful风格的url进行规整;规整方式包含startwith,endwith,include
在运行中始终不保存任何数据或状态的工作负载称为“无状态工作负载(deployment)”。如果已使用CCE或开源Kubernetes部署Deployment应用,启动配置脚本可以将Deployment应用接入APM,即可在拓扑、事务界面上查看应用情况。 商用 Deployment应用接入APM
ode.js应用的JVM数据,那么对应有JVM采集器,一个采集器会采集多个指标集的数据。详细的采集器及指标集信息请参见采集中心。 采集器被部署到环境后形成监控项,在数据采集的时候监控项决定了采集的数据结构和采集行为。 采集周期:监控项具有数据采集器的周期属性。当前数据采集周期为一分钟,不支持用户调整。
APM工具通常基于ASM框架进行字节码插桩。这种技术允许开发者动态修改应用程序的字节码,以便在不改变源代码的情况下监控性能。 然而,若同时安装多个APM工具,会导致代码多次插桩。不同产品的实现可能相互冲突,进而引发编译错误和性能问题。例如,一个工具可能会修改某个方法的字节码,而另
line_view_config LineViewConfigModel object 指向线视图配置。 detail_view_config DetailViewConfigModel object 详情视图配置。 表7 LineViewConfigModel 参数 参数类型 描述 metric_set
JAVA false 2.0.0 - 调用链中是否采集上报带有参数内容的原始sql 汇聚分表表名 array JAVA - 2.2.2 - 根据配置的表名,汇聚分表的sql。以该表名开头的表汇聚成同样的表名 mysql最大采集行数 integer JAVA 500 2.4.1 - 可采集的mysql最大行数
测试流程 在不安装探针的情况下,分别使用1TPS、500TPS、1000TPS、2000TPS压测样本,每次的持续时长为30分钟,压测结果将作为基线性能指标。 安装探针,采样策略设置为智能采样和100%采样两种情况下,重复步骤1的压测过程,对比CPU、内存、RT上的差异。 安装带Pro
设置PubkeyAuthentication的值为yes。 service sshd restart 获取checkSsh.sh脚本,更改配置并设置执行权限。 获取脚本。 下载地址:https://icagent-{region}.obs.{region}.myhuaweicloud
据。同理,对于部署在多个弹性云服务器上的分布式应用,如果弹性云服务器之间的时间不一致,则会导致数据无法成链,那么在采集代理处理时就会有异常,而查询时,也可能显示明显异常的数据。 所以,在安装ICAgent前务必要保证服务器之间、浏览器与服务器之间的时间一致。如何安装ICAgent
Kubernetes如何接入APM 通过修改deployment.yaml接入APM 通过安装Helm方式接入APM 父主题: 接入APM